12/11/2010, 19:56
|
| | Fecha de Ingreso: junio-2010 Ubicación: Charlotte, NC
Mensajes: 611
Antigüedad: 14 años, 5 meses Puntos: 95 | |
Respuesta: Retroceder una línia en la pantalla Eso es una funcion especifica del sistema operativo, y no existe ninguna instruccion en el lenguaje de programacion que te permita hacer eso.
Veras tanto printf como cout, te permiten imprimir cosas en la consola, mas no manipularla.
puedes intentar escribir, pero me parece que solo te funcionaria en terminales unix.
cout<<"\e[A";
mas no estoy seguro que
una alternativa, es almacenar lo que has ido escribiendo en la pantalla en una estructura de datos, ya sea un array o un arbol, de tal manera que si quieres hacer una actualizacion a una linea que ya has escrito, consultas tu estructura de datos, haces la modificacion, limpias la pantalla y escribes el contenido de la estructura de datos nuevamente. |